Poa annua agg.

Habitus and growth type

  • Height [m]: 0.05–0.25
    ?
  • Growth form: annual herb, clonal herb
    ?
  • Life form: hemicryptophyte, therophyte
    ?
  • Life strategy: R – ruderal
    ?

Leaf

  • Leaf presence and metamorphosis: leaves present, not modified
    ?
  • Leaf arrangement (phyllotaxis): alternate
    ?
  • Leaf shape: simple – entire
    ?
  • Stipules: absent
    ?
  • Petiole: absent
    ?
  • Leaf life span: evergreen
    ?
  • Leaf anatomy: mesomorphic, hygromorphic
    ?

Flower

  • Flowering period [month]: January–December
    ?
  • Flowering phase: 2 Acer platanoides-Anemone nemorosa (start of early spring)
    ?
  • Flower colour: green
    ?
  • Perianth type: reduced
    ?
  • Perianth fusion: reduced
    ?
  • Inflorescence type: panicula e spiculis composita
    ?
  • Dicliny: synoecious, gynomonoecious
    ?
  • Generative reproduction type: facultative autogamy, mixed mating
    ?
  • Pollination syndrome: wind-pollination, selfing, cleistogamy
    ?

Fruit, seed and dispersal

  • Fruit type: dry fruit – caryopsis
    ?
  • Fruit colour: brown
    ?
  • Reproduction type: by seed/spores and vegetatively, mostly by seed/spores, rarely vegetatively
    ?
  • Dispersal unit (diaspore): fruit, infrutescence or its part
    ?
  • Dispersal strategy: Allium (mainly autochory)
    ?
  • Myrmecochory: non-myrmecochorous (a)
    ?

Karyology

  • Chromosome number (2n): 14, 28
    ?
  • Ploidy level (x): 2, 4
    ?
  • 2C genome size [Mbp]: 2615.68
    ?
  • 1Cx monoploid genome size [Mbp]: 834.62
    ?

Taxon origin

  • Origin in the Czech Republic: native
    ?

Ecological indicator values

  • Ellenberg-type indicator values

  • Light indicator value: 7 – half-light plant, mostly occurring at full light, but also in the shade up to about 30% of diffuse radiation incident in an open area
    ?
  • Temperature indicator value: 5 – moderate heat indicator, occurring from lowland to montane belt, mainly in submontane-temperate areas
    ?
  • Moisture indicator value: 6 – transition between values 5 and 7
    ?
  • Reaction indicator value: 6 – transition between values 5 and 7
    ?
  • Nutrient indicator value: 8 – pronounced nutrient indicator
    ?
  • Salinity indicator value: 1 – salt tolerant, mostly on low-salt to salt-free soils, but occasionally on slightly salty soils
    ?
